Huacai Chen
195615ecc8 MIPS: Loongson-3: Enable COP2 usage in kernel
Loongson-3's COP2 is Multi-Media coprocessor, it is disabled in kernel
mode by default. However, gslq/gssq (16-bytes load/store instructions)
overrides the instruction format of lwc2/swc2. If we wan't to use gslq/
gssq for optimization in kernel, we should enable COP2 usage in kernel.

Please pay attention that in this patch we only enable COP2 in kernel,
which means it will lose ST0_CU2 when a process go to user space (try
to use COP2 in user space will trigger an exception and then grab COP2,
which is similar to FPU). And as a result, we need to modify the context
switching code because the new scheduled process doesn't contain ST0_CU2
in its THERAD_STATUS probably.

For zboot, we disable gslq/gssq be generated by toolchain.

Al Viro
c693cc4676 saner calling conventions for csum_and_copy_..._user()
All callers of these primitives will
	* discard anything we might've copied in case of error
	* ignore the csum value in case of error
	* always pass 0xffffffff as the initial sum, so the
resulting csum value (in case of success, that is) will never be 0.

That suggest the following calling conventions:
	* don't pass err_ptr - just return 0 on error.
	* don't bother with zeroing destination, etc. in case of error
	* don't pass the initial sum - just use 0xffffffff.

This commit does the minimal conversion in the instances of csum_and_copy_...();
the changes of actual asm code behind them are done later in the series.
Note that this asm code is often shared with csum_partial_copy_nocheck();
the difference is that csum_partial_copy_nocheck() passes 0 for initial
sum while csum_and_copy_..._user() pass 0xffffffff.  Fortunately, we are
free to pass 0xffffffff in all cases and subsequent patches will use that
freedom without any special comments.

A part that could be split off: parisc and uml/i386 claimed to have
csum_and_copy_to_user() instances of their own, but those were identical
to the generic one, so we simply drop them.  Not sure if it's worth
a separate commit...

Al Viro
6e41c585e3 unify generic instances of csum_partial_copy_nocheck()
quite a few architectures have the same csum_partial_copy_nocheck() -
simply memcpy() the data and then return the csum of the copy.

hexagon, parisc, ia64, s390, um: explicitly spelled out that way.

arc, arm64, csky, h8300, m68k/nommu, microblaze, mips/GENERIC_CSUM, nds32,
nios2, openrisc, riscv, unicore32: end up picking the same thing spelled
out in lib/checksum.h (with varying amounts of perversions along the way).

everybody else (alpha, arm, c6x, m68k/mmu, mips/!GENERIC_CSUM, powerpc,
sh, sparc, x86, xtensa) have non-generic variants.  For all except c6x
the declaration is in their asm/checksum.h.  c6x uses the wrapper
from asm-generic/checksum.h that would normally lead to the lib/checksum.h
instance, but in case of c6x we end up using an asm function from arch/c6x
instead.

Screw that mess - have architectures with private instances define
_HAVE_ARCH_CSUM_AND_COPY in their asm/checksum.h and have the default
one right in net/checksum.h conditional on _HAVE_ARCH_CSUM_AND_COPY
*not* defined.

Thomas Gleixner
4c5a116ada vdso/treewide: Add vdso_data pointer argument to __arch_get_hw_counter()
MIPS already uses and S390 will need the vdso data pointer in
__arch_get_hw_counter().

This works nicely as long as the architecture does not support time
namespaces in the VDSO. With time namespaces enabled the regular
accessor to the vdso data pointer __arch_get_vdso_data() will return the
namespace specific VDSO data page for tasks which are part of a
non-root time namespace. This would cause the architectures which need
the vdso data pointer in __arch_get_hw_counter() to access the wrong
vdso data page.

Add a vdso_data pointer argument to __arch_get_hw_counter() and hand it in
from the call sites in the core code. For architectures which do not need
the data pointer in their counter accessor function the compiler will just
optimize it out.

Fix up all existing architecture implementations and make MIPS utilize the
pointer instead of invoking the accessor function.

No functional change and no change in the resulting object code (except
MIPS).

WANG Xuerui
bc6e8dc112 MIPS: handle Loongson-specific GSExc exception
Newer Loongson cores (Loongson-3A R2 and newer) use the
implementation-dependent ExcCode 16 to signal Loongson-specific
exceptions. The extended cause is put in the non-standard CP0.Diag1
register which is CP0 Register 22 Select 1, called GSCause in Loongson
manuals. Inside is an exception code bitfield called GSExcCode, only
codes 0 to 6 inclusive are documented (so far, in the Loongson 3A3000
User Manual, Volume 2).

During experiments, it was found that some undocumented unprivileged
instructions can trigger the also-undocumented GSExcCode 8 on Loongson
3A4000. Processor state is not corrupted, but we cannot continue without
further knowledge, and Loongson is not providing that information as of
this writing. So we send SIGILL on seeing this exception code to thwart
easy local DoS attacks.

Other exception codes are made fatal, partly because of insufficient
knowledge, also partly because they are not as easily reproduced. None
of them are encountered in the wild with upstream kernels and userspace
so far.

Some older cores (Loongson-3A1000 and Loongson-3B1500) have ExcCode 16
too, but the semantic is equivalent to GSExcCode 0. Because the
respective manuals did not mention the CP0.Diag1 register or its read
behavior, these cores are not covered in this patch, as MFC0 from
non-existent CP0 registers is UNDEFINED according to the MIPS
architecture spec.

Tiezhu Yang
67d0662ce9 MIPS: Prevent READ_IMPLIES_EXEC propagation
In the MIPS architecture, we should clear the security-relevant
flag READ_IMPLIES_EXEC in the function SET_PERSONALITY2() of the
file arch/mips/include/asm/elf.h.

Otherwise, with this flag set, PROT_READ implies PROT_EXEC for
mmap to make memory executable that is not safe, because this
condition allows an attacker to simply jump to and execute bytes
that are considered to be just data [1].

In mm/mmap.c:
unsigned long do_mmap(struct file *file, unsigned long addr,
			unsigned long len, unsigned long prot,
			unsigned long flags, vm_flags_t vm_flags,
			unsigned long pgoff, unsigned long *populate,
			struct list_head *uf)
{
	[...]
	if ((prot & PROT_READ) && (current->personality & READ_IMPLIES_EXEC))
		if (!(file && path_noexec(&file->f_path)))
			prot |= PROT_EXEC;
	[...]
}

By the way, x86 and ARM64 have done the similar thing.

After commit 250c22777f ("x86_64: move kernel"), in the file
arch/x86/kernel/process_64.c:
void set_personality_64bit(void)
{
	[...]
	current->personality &= ~READ_IMPLIES_EXEC;
}

After commit 48f99c8ec0 ("arm64: Preventing READ_IMPLIES_EXEC
propagation"), in the file arch/arm64/include/asm/elf.h:
#define SET_PERSONALITY(ex)						\
({									\
	clear_thread_flag(TIF_32BIT);					\
	current->personality &= ~READ_IMPLIES_EXEC;			\
})

[1] https://insights.sei.cmu.edu/cert/2014/02/feeling-insecure-blame-your-parent.html

Kees Cook
fe4bfff86e seccomp: Use -1 marker for end of mode 1 syscall list
The terminator for the mode 1 syscalls list was a 0, but that could be
a valid syscall number (e.g. x86_64 __NR_read). By luck, __NR_read was
listed first and the loop construct would not test it, so there was no
bug. However, this is fragile. Replace the terminator with -1 instead,
and make the variable name for mode 1 syscall lists more descriptive.
